About
Jonathan C. Nesbitt is a cardiothoracic surgeon and researcher dedicated to advancing surgical education and patient outcomes through objective performance assessment. His primary research focuses on leveraging robotic surgical data to quantify technical skill, reduce operative errors, and improve training in cardiothoracic surgery. Nesbitt’s most impactful work, cited 19 times, established that objective performance indicators (OPIs) derived from robotic kinematic and system data can predict vascular injury during simulated robotic-assisted lobectomy—a critical step toward competency-based training. He further demonstrated that these digital metrics can reliably differentiate between attending and trainee surgeons, offering a path to replace subjective evaluations with unbiased, data-driven feedback. Nesbitt also contributed to clinical innovation by reporting the short-term outcomes of robotic-assisted transthoracic diaphragmatic plication, a minimally invasive alternative to open thoracotomy for symptomatic diaphragmatic dysfunction. His work bridges the gap between surgical simulation, real-world performance, and patient safety, positioning him as a leader in the integration of quantitative analytics into surgical education and practice.
